/*
 * MAX_CACHED_THUMBNAILS caps the in-memory image cache for the
 * Fernhollow viewer. Before this limit existed, decoded bitmaps were
 * retained indefinitely because eviction callbacks never fired on
 * background tabs, leaking roughly 4 MB per gallery view. Security
 * review note: the leak also kept decrypted previews resident longer
 * than policy allows. The fix landed in the build noted below.
 */

session token of tajef-bageg = htk21_5d90d574934f3ccae6437

Subject: DR drill Thursday — SketchLoom undo stack

Hi folks! Quick heads-up for our new teammates: Thursday's disaster-recovery drill simulates losing the undo/redo history service in SketchLoom, our diagram editor. We'll restore the command log from the warm replica and replay it. To unlock the replica snapshot, you'll need the recovery passphrase below.

unlock words, yawig-kagef: gordor-holvan-ulaael-pramir-ulaiel-tamdor

To the sales leads: the plan approved by the operating committee adds nine sales roles overall. Allocation: four to the Western territory, three to enterprise accounts supporting the Corvail launch, two to inside sales. Backfills for attrition are pre-approved only for quota-carrying positions; all others route through Helene's office. Hiring opens in the second quarter, contingent on first-quarter bookings. No changes to comp structure are planned. The rationale driving these allocations appears in the note below.

internal memo for faweg-tafog: Only 7 of the 100 pilot accounts renewed Quenael, so a churn review is set for April 15.

MEMO — Records Team

Re: Trophy engraving, Glimmerfall Awards Night

Folks, the engraved trophies for Friday are done at Harrowtide Engravers and boxed up. Please log each plaque name against the winners list before they leave the building — last year's mix-up still haunts us. A courier collects them Thursday morning. For the pickup itself, note the following confidential instruction.

courier memo of yahif-faweg: the quenael tamius courier leaves the prawyn jorix kaswyn istox silmir brieth zormir fenvan ledger at gate 3145 under passcode 231062